PNY has just revealed what could be the fastest PCIe 4.0 SSD currently on the market, the XLR8 CS3140, an M.2 NVMe SSD that’s rated to deliver sequential read speeds of up to 7,500 MB/s and write speeds of up to 6,850 MB/s.

According to a recent report coming via Reuters, Intel’s first discrete gaming graphics card based on the Xe-HPG graphics architecture will be fabbed on TSMC’s enhanced version of its 7-nanometer process node, with Reuters citing sources “familiar with the matter.”
